The Photographer's Exploration to Varanasi's Iconic Ghats

Photographing Varanasi's historic ghats presents a unique opportunity for any passionate photographer. Remember the early morning light – the “golden time ” – as the rays paints the structures and the rituals unfolding along the shoreline . Be ready for a sensory immersion; the rich colors, the constant noise of life, and the sheer volume of people can be overwhelming . Center your gaze on the details – the weathered faces of the worshippers, the intricate carvings on the shrines , and the gentle movement of the Ganges . Acknowledge the traditional customs and invariably seek consent before capturing individuals. Ultimately, portraying Varanasi’s ghats is more than just capturing pictures; it's about telling a powerful story.
